加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com.cn/)- 混合云存储、媒体处理、应用安全、安全管理、数据分析!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

交互视角下的SQL性能监控实战

发布时间:2026-01-01 16:30:01 所属栏目:MsSql教程 来源:DaWei
导读:  在交互设计的视角下,我们通常关注用户与系统之间的互动流程是否顺畅、直观。然而,当涉及到后台数据库的性能问题时,这种关注往往被忽视。实际上,SQL性能直接影响到系统的响应速度和用户体验,是交互设计不可忽

  在交互设计的视角下,我们通常关注用户与系统之间的互动流程是否顺畅、直观。然而,当涉及到后台数据库的性能问题时,这种关注往往被忽视。实际上,SQL性能直接影响到系统的响应速度和用户体验,是交互设计不可忽视的重要组成部分。


  在实际工作中,我曾遇到过一个案例:某个页面加载时间异常缓慢,用户反馈频繁出现“加载中”的提示。通过分析发现,问题根源在于一条复杂的SQL查询语句,它没有合理使用索引,导致数据库需要扫描大量数据。


  作为交互设计师,我们需要从用户的角度出发,理解他们与系统交互时的每一个动作背后的技术支撑。当用户点击按钮或刷新页面时,背后的SQL执行效率决定了他们的等待时间。如果这个过程过长,用户可能会失去耐心,甚至放弃使用。


  因此,在设计交互流程时,我们也应该考虑如何优化数据库查询。比如,可以通过预加载数据、减少不必要的查询次数、合理使用缓存等方式来提升整体性能。这些措施不仅提升了技术层面的效率,也间接改善了用户的交互体验。


  监控SQL性能也是日常维护的一部分。我们可以借助工具如慢查询日志、执行计划分析等手段,定期检查数据库的运行状态。这不仅能帮助我们及时发现问题,还能为后续的优化提供数据支持。


  在实际操作中,我会与开发团队紧密合作,共同制定性能优化方案。例如,在设计表结构时,提前考虑索引的使用;在编写SQL时,避免使用复杂的子查询,尽量简化逻辑。这些看似微小的调整,却能在实际应用中带来显著的性能提升。


AI生成内容图,仅供参考

  站长个人见解,交互设计师不仅要关注界面和流程的设计,还应具备一定的技术敏感度,尤其是在涉及数据库性能的问题上。只有将交互体验与技术实现紧密结合,才能真正打造高效、流畅的用户服务。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章